Output 90fbd5ae6ecef18aa1691d8ef32014232e1e342d748f9543231243757232d14a:0

value
6216398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53f610898513d1a0786c33ebe10c329253d5b1a OP_EQUAL
address
3JDN9vBfSqF7Zr3A5o7vXMAXcEp3xhdWqx
transaction
90fbd5ae6ecef18aa1691d8ef32014232e1e342d748f9543231243757232d14a
spent
true